‘We would all be there in a heartbeat’: Top Gun: Maverick Star Jay Ellis on a Sequel (And Who Would Show Up)

Jay Ellis reassures "to be there" if there would be a potential sequel to Top Gun: Maverick.
Featured Video

The Top Gun:Maverick star Jay Ellis is not sure or even thinks that there would not be a sequel to the movie but with that, he also admits the fact that he could be wrong. With that, he also believes that the whole cast and crew would love to be there for a potential sequel, that is, if there would be any. He also agreed that if the director has something in his mind about taking the movie forward, then he would gratefully be a part of the project. He also talked about how Tom Cruise had made him feel about it all.

Top Gun:Maverick main lead and a mega star, Tom Cruise had been like a mentor to Jay Ellis

Tom Cruise in Top Gun, a 1986 mega-hit movie.
Tom Cruise in Top Gun, a 1986 mega-hit movie.

During The American Foundation for AIDS Research (amfAR) annual gala in Los Angeles, when asked about the possibility and thoughts about a sequel for Top Gun:Maverick, Jay Ellis also talked about how Tom Cruise had been there for every cast and crew. He also added that Cruise would remind the whole of the cast how “special” it was to make this movie.

Ellis also complimented Tom Cruise, saying that he[Cruise] is his mentor and has a strong point of view. Also, added to the list is that he is someone with whom one may easily communicate. Cruise had shared with Ellis some words of encouragement, saying that he is an action movie star.

All this was during the fundraising event held for the amfAR at the annual gala in LA, as could be observed. This money is raised for HIV/AIDS Research programs. This year’s gala raised over $1.3 million, and last year’s event helped raise over $1.7 million.
